NEC Asia Pacific takes part in Cloud Expo Asia 2018

Enhancing customer experience through AI and IoT data-driven solutions with predictive analytics powered by the Cloud

Singapore, 3 October 2018 - NEC Asia Pacific today announced its participation in Cloud Expo Asia, Asia’s biggest cloud and digital transformation show, held at the Marina Bay Sands Expo and Convention Centre in Singapore, 10-11 October 2018.

In today’s digital age, the convergence of Big Data, the Cloud, the Internet of Things, and many related innovations have brought about profound changes to cities, businesses, and the lives of people who are part of them. At the same time, because these technologies have created bountiful opportunities, businesses in every industry need to understand how to utilize these technological advances to stay competitive.

In the 2-day showcase, NEC will present a number of cloud-based solutions utilizing AI and IoT technology in a wide variety of sectors, such as Retail, Transport, and Healthcare.

For the first time in Singapore, NEC will showcase a next-generation smart retail solution utilizing NEC’s facial recognition technology (which is recognized as the world's most accurate) (*), object recognition, and artificial intelligence technologies. This solution opens new possibilities for retailers to deliver a more personalized and smarter shopping experience, by recognizing pre-registered customers’ faces at the shop entrance, offering a promotion or recommendation based on the customers’ purchasing history, and allowing swift check-out via facial recognition, which eliminates the need to queue at a cash register.

More key highlights include:

1.    Transportation: Using AI towards Smooth and Convenient Public Transport
The NEC NeoCenter for Public Transport uses AI technology to reduce commuter waiting time for public buses, thereby increasing commuter satisfaction.

Buses are equipped with IoT-enabled devices that transmit telematic data back to the bus operation center, which is used together with AI prediction to estimate and optimize bus arrival/departure times.

2.    Liveable cities: Intelligent Video Data Mining
NeoCenter includes an intelligent video data mining platform that correlates and searches for scenes of interest applicable to operators, easing their efforts in performing manual video mining. Less manpower is required, and scenes of interest can be found in real-time for greater convenience.

3.    Liveable cities: Gaze Analytics For An Enriched Consumer Experience
NEC’s Gaze Detection technology shows information that a consumer is most interested in at a kiosk just by reading his/her eye gaze, without the need for multiple screens or a touch screen.

4.    Liveable Cities: NeoCentre Mobile
Facial Recognition performed through a body-worn camera, to allow for rapid and accurate identification of Persons Of Interest. This IoT device can be used flexibly, by either connecting to the backend system or working independently. Similarly, processing and image storage can be done on either the Cloud, or independently.

5.    Healthcare: Stroke Patient Recovery Prediction System
Using AI technology to measure patients’ health data with respect to stroke conditions, and predicting patients’ recovery periods, leading to increased hospital running efficiency, and a higher Quality of Life.
